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30253983 48733944794 24753 2210689028 632658992
8728923065 9993
8728923065 9993
49568 128 8718569
All about undefined
Interested in learning more?
8728923065 9993
49568 128 8718569
See more
9840 50
7252479 97701499 7535218635
See more
5904 652722603
513032597 7281631 8647 16375
See more